Output 7fd8492f314954570dc521b60b959d3f527dd05f91a77d5fc4d26c3eafeaf758:5

value
650283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4383c420ab763adb893e8d2ba7b4d21a205ad9c7 OP_EQUAL
address
37r13feZhEow3yr1Bx1w4fekxE47YFpfJr
transaction
7fd8492f314954570dc521b60b959d3f527dd05f91a77d5fc4d26c3eafeaf758
spent
true